| Cheap Flights (Tips on how to get them) I'm looking to visit friends in Kenya next year. Cheapest flights I can see for when I wanna go (January-Febuary sorta time) are all about £450 which is a bit on the steep side. But there are so many sites that say the search the prices of every major airline so why do they all offer different prices for the "cheapest flight available".
I'm very confused. What sites do you use for cheap flights? Is it better to go through the airlines site rather than a third party and compare yourself?

| Re: Cheap Flights (Tips on how to get them) I used 'opodo' when I bought tickets to New York...seemed to throw up the best deal after a lot of searching (bout £350 return inc. taxes (and that's for mid July)). Then tried getting them direct from the airline (USAirways) but was having problems as it's an american airline and has a shit website...the only method of paying I could find was an American phone number so just ended up buying through Opodo. Final cost came through on my card as like a £10 charge to opodo and £340 to USAir so they don't take a huge cut.
Also, being flexible with which Airport you fly from and which days you'll fly can bring the cost down a lot. Flights from Manchester (which is where i'm flying from) were consistently about £150 cheaper than from Glasgow and all the cheapest fares were on a Tue/Wed.
Looking quickly though...£450 sounds quite cheap... |

| Re: Cheap Flights (Tips on how to get them) I use a variety of sources, but leaving from the UK I usually use: http://www.airline-network.co.uk/
THEN.. take the flight info from there are see if I can get the same price for the same flight directly from the airline.. even if it's £10 or £20 more expensive, it's worthwhile getting the ticket direct from the carrier, rather than a third party. Means if anything goes wrong, you've got a bit more back up.
